That's what you get for using a "balanced" team rather than plowing through everything with your starter.
You might not know this, but the main point of Pokémon is to battle your friends. To even begin to do this, you need to level six things to Lv. 100. And that's just for a single bare minimum team. And if you want to do it well, you have to level them from newborns and according to invisible secret stats. Hundreds to thousands of hours needed just to be able to play the "real" game.

Compare to a fighter like MvC3. To play the "real" game, you similarly need to invest hundreds to thousands of hours training in the systems of the game to be able to achieve anything the characters are capable of at your whim, but you have to train yourself to be better, as opposed to mindlessly mashing A for 1000 hours to make your artifical stats raise. This is why Pokémon is bad and why MvC3 is good. One flushes your time down the toilet; one invests your time in a skill.
